About Delph Hill

Delph Hill unfolds as a quiet residential expanse within the broader tapestry of West Yorkshire. It lies 4.8 km north-west of Cleckheaton (from Cleckheaton: bearing 304°T, OS grid SE 149 279), and is situated north-north-east of Norwood Green village.
